Si alguna vez has visto el mensaje de error "Error al establecer una conexión a la base de datos" al intentar acceder a tu sitio de WordPress, no te preocupes. Es un error bastante común y se puede solucionar fácilmente. Este artículo te mostrará cómo solucionarlo.
Primero, veamos qué significa este error y por qué ocurre. El error "Estableciendo una conexión a la base de datos" significa que WordPress no puede conectarse a la base de datos. Esto puede ocurrir por varias razones, entre ellas:
La información de conexión de la base de datos en su archivo wp-config.php es incorrecta:
- Su servidor de base de datos está inactivo
- Su base de datos ha sido dañada
Para solucionar este problema, revisa el archivo wp-config.php para ver si tiene errores tipográficos o errores. Intenta reiniciar el servidor de base de datos. Si ninguna de estas soluciones funciona, quizás tengas que contactar con tu proveedor de alojamiento o con expertos en WordPress para solucionar el problema.
¿Por qué hay un error al establecer una conexión a la base de datos?
Puedes ver el mensaje "Error al establecer una conexión a la base de datos" en WordPress por varias razones. La más común es que tus credenciales de la base de datos (nombre de usuario, contraseña, nombre de host, etc.) sean incorrectas. Otras causas incluyen las siguientes:
-Su servidor de base de datos está inactivo o es inaccesible.
-Tus archivos de WordPress están dañados.
-Su base de datos de WordPress está dañada.
Si ve este mensaje de error, verifique las credenciales de su base de datos y asegúrese de que sean correctas. Si lo son, el siguiente paso es verificar si su servidor de base de datos está funcionando. Si está inactivo o no se puede acceder a él, deberá contactar a su proveedor de alojamiento para que solucione el problema.
Si tu servidor de base de datos está funcionando, pero sigues viendo el mensaje de error, podría deberse a daños en tus archivos o base de datos de WordPress. En ese caso, tendrás que restaurar tu sitio desde una copia de seguridad.
¡Solucione el error de conexión a la base de datos de WordPress con ocho métodos sencillos!
Si experimentas un error al establecer una conexión a la base de datos en WordPress, no te preocupes. Es un error común que se puede solucionar fácilmente.
A continuación, se presentan ocho soluciones para corregir el error "Conexión a la base de datos" de WordPress. Crear una copia de seguridad de su sitio es lo primero que debe hacer antes de probar cualquiera de estas soluciones. Asegurarse de tener una copia de seguridad disponible le ayudará a evitar problemas si tiene que restaurar su sitio.
Método n.° 1: Actualizar el complemento de su navegador
Si se produce un error de conexión a la base de datos de WordPress, debería actualizar el plugin de su navegador. Esto se debe a que podría necesitar actualizarse y ser compatible con la última versión de WordPress.
Para actualizar el complemento de su navegador, siga estos pasos:
1. Vaya a la página 'Actualizaciones' en su panel de WordPress y haga clic en 'Buscar actualizaciones'
2. Si hay una actualización disponible para el complemento de su navegador, haga clic en el botón "Actualizar ahora".
3. Una vez completada la actualización, intenta acceder de nuevo a tu sitio web. Si el problema persiste, continúa con el siguiente método.
Método n.° 2: Borrar la caché
Si sigues viendo el error de conexión a la base de datos de WordPress, puedes intentar borrar la caché. Esto obligará a tu navegador a cargar la versión más reciente de tu sitio, donde podría estar instalada la solución.
Para borrar la caché, abre el navegador y pulsa Ctrl + Mayús + Suprimir (en Windows) o Cmd + Mayús + Suprimir (en Mac). Se abrirá una nueva ventana con opciones. Asegúrate de que todas las opciones estén seleccionadas y haz clic en "Borrar datos de navegación"
Una vez borrada la caché, intenta cargar tu sitio de nuevo. Si el error de conexión a la base de datos de WordPress persiste, continúa con el siguiente método.
Método n.° 3: comprobar la conexión a la base de datos
Si sigue viendo el error de conexión a la base de datos de WordPress, lo siguiente que debe verificar es su conexión a la base de datos.
Hay algunas maneras de hacer esto:
Compruebe el archivo wp-config.php
La primera forma es revisar el archivo wp-config.php de tu sitio de WordPress. Este archivo contiene la información de conexión a tu base de datos; si es incorrecta, verás un error de conexión a la base de datos de WordPress.
Para comprobar su archivo wp-config.php:
- Inicie sesión en su sitio de WordPress a través de FTP.
- Descargue el archivo wp-config.php a su computadora.
- Abra el archivo en un editor de texto como el Bloc de notas o TextEdit.
- Busque las siguientes líneas de código:
define('DB_NAME', 'nombre_de_base_de_datos');
define('DB_USER', 'nombre_de_usuario_de_base_de_datos');
define('DB_PASSWORD', 'contraseña_de_base_de_datos');
define('DB_HOST,' 'localhost');
Dependiendo de tu configuración de hosting, estas líneas tendrán un aspecto diferente, pero todas deberían estar presentes de alguna forma. Si alguna de estas líneas falta o contiene información incorrecta, podría estar causando el error de conexión a la base de datos de WordPress en tu sitio.
- Una vez que haya verificado que toda la información es correcta, guarde el archivo y cárguelo.
Método n.° 4: Borrar las cookies de su navegador
Uno de los errores más comunes de WordPress es el error de conexión a la base de datos . Este error suele ocurrir cuando hay un problema con la base de datos o la configuración de WordPress. Afortunadamente, existen métodos sencillos para solucionarlo.
Un método es borrar las cookies de tu navegador. Esto restablecerá tu inicio de sesión de WordPress y te permitirá volver a acceder a tu sitio. Para ello, ve a la configuración de tu navegador y borra las cookies del sitio web.
Método n.° 5: eliminar el archivo de hosts de WordPress
El error de conexión a la base de datos de WordPress es un problema común que puede ocurrir por varias razones. Una posible razón es que el archivo de host de WordPress esté dañado o contenga información incorrecta.
Para solucionar esto, puedes eliminar el archivo de hosts de WordPress. Esto restablecerá el archivo a su estado predeterminado y solucionará el error de conexión a la base de datos.
Para ello, primero localice el archivo de hosts de WordPress. En la mayoría de los sistemas, se encuentra en la siguiente ubicación:
/etc/hosts
Una vez que haya localizado el archivo, elimínelo y reinicie su servidor web. Su sitio de WordPress debería estar accesible y el error de conexión a la base de datos debería estar solucionado.
Método n.° 6: Restablecer la base de datos de WordPress
Si enfrenta un error de conexión a la base de datos de WordPress, lo primero que debe hacer es restablecer su base de datos de WordPress.
Puede hacerlo accediendo a su base de datos desde su cPanel. Una vez dentro, seleccione todas las tablas y elimínelas. Esto eliminará todos los datos de su base de datos y le permitirá comenzar de cero. Después, podrá recrear sus tablas e importar los datos desde una copia de seguridad.
Esto también se puede hacer utilizando la herramienta WP-CLI.
Primero, debes conectarte a tu sitio de WordPress mediante SSH. Una vez conectado, accede al directorio raíz de tu sitio de WordPress.
Luego debes ejecutar el siguiente comando:
Restablecimiento de base de datos de wp –sí
Esto restablecerá su base de datos de WordPress y con suerte solucionará el error de conexión.
Método n.° 7: Reparar los archivos dañados
Si recibes el error de conexión a la base de datos de WordPress, lo más probable es que esté dañada. Hay varias maneras de solucionar este problema, pero la más común es usar una herramienta como WP-DBManager.
WP-DBManager es un plugin que te permite reparar tu base de datos de WordPress. Instálalo y haz clic en el botón "Reparar". El plugin revisará tu base de datos y reparará los archivos dañados.
Una vez completada la reparación, debería poder acceder a su sitio de WordPress sin problemas. Si los problemas persisten, póngase en contacto con su proveedor de alojamiento y pídale que investigue el problema.
Método n.° 8: crear una nueva base de datos
Si se produce un error de conexión a la base de datos de WordPress, una de las opciones es crear una nueva base de datos. Este proceso es relativamente sencillo y se realiza siguiendo estos pasos:
1. Inicie sesión en su cuenta de alojamiento y vaya al cPanel.
2. En el cPanel, desplácese hacia abajo hasta la sección Bases de datos y haga clic en Bases de datos MySQL.
3. En la siguiente página, verá un campo donde puede introducir el nombre de la nueva base de datos. Introduzca un nombre para la nueva base de datos (recuerde este nombre, ya que lo necesitará más adelante) y haga clic en "Crear base de datos"
4. Una vez creada la base de datos, deberá crear un usuario. Para ello, desplácese hasta la sección Usuarios de MySQL y haga clic en "Agregar nuevo usuario".
5. En la página siguiente, ingrese un nombre de usuario y una contraseña para su nuevo usuario de base de datos (asegúrese de recordar este nombre de usuario y contraseña, ya que los necesitará más adelante) y luego haga clic en Crear usuario.
6. Ahora que ha creado una nueva base de datos y un usuario, debe asignar ese usuario a la base de datos. Para ello, desplácese de nuevo hasta la sección Bases de datos MySQL y haga clic en Agregar usuario a la base de datos.
7. En la página siguiente, seleccione su nueva base de datos en el menú desplegable y luego elija su nuevo usuario de base de datos en el otro menú desplegable antes de hacer clic en el botón Agregar.
Métodos adicionales para solucionar el error de conexión a la base de datos de WordPress
Por último, puedes intentar cambiar tu contraseña de WordPress. Esto solo debe hacerse si estás seguro de que tu contraseña actual no funciona. Para cambiar tu contraseña:
- Vaya a su panel de WordPress y haga clic en la pestaña “Usuarios”.
- Haga clic en “Su perfil” e ingrese una nueva contraseña en el campo “Nueva contraseña”.
- Utilice una contraseña segura que incluya letras, números y caracteres especiales.
Conclusión
¡Listo! Estas son algunas maneras comunes de solucionar el error al establecer una conexión a la base de datos en WordPress. Contacta con tu proveedor de alojamiento para obtener más ayuda para poner en marcha tu sitio web.
Una vez resuelto el problema del error, aquí hay algunas otras guías que le ayudarán a mejorar el rendimiento de su sitio web: